Pistachiosor other nuts of choice.

I love pistachios for flavour and for their lovely green colour.

Almonds, walnuts, macadamia and hazelnuts would also work well.

Creamy Feta Dip with crudités - vegetable sticks

Chilli flakes/ red pepper flakes Just a pinch, for a hint of warmth!

Lemon zest Optional, for an additional final sprinkle of fresh lemon.

If Im long on lemons, Ill add it.

It will take 10 to 20 seconds if youre using creamy Danish feta, as the recipe calls for.

Article image

It can take a few minutes if youre using crumbly Greek feta.

Dents & swirls Make big dents/swirls across the surface of the dip using the back of a dessert spoon.

We just want nice big dents for pools of honey and olive oil to settle in.

Toppings Drizzle and sprinkle with toppings.
